Synthesis of strigolactone and karrikin analogues by gold mediated cyclisation Ghent University
Karrikins and strigolactones are plant hormones which share a common signaling cascade, and a common structural butenolide feature. A newly developped gold catalysed rearrangement is used to obtain new butenolide analogues in order to shed light on the biological pathways involved and to obtain useful new agrochemicals.
